Job Summary
Assist the finance department with daily accounting operations and support financial reporting, budgeting, audits, and compliance activities. Gain cross-functional experience through rotations in finance, legal, HR, administration, supply chain, customer service, and after-sales.
Responsibilities
- Enter vouchers and maintain ledgers to ensure accurate daily accounting records
- Prepare and analyze mon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ements to support management decisions
- Process invoices, reimbursements, and payment requests while ensuring compliance with financial policies
- Participate in budget preparation and monitor budget execution through tracking and analysis
- Organize and compile financial data to provide reliable data support for reporting and audits
- Assist in completing audits, tax filings, and other finance-related compliance tasks
- Collaborate effectively across departments during rotation opportunities in finance, legal, human resources, administration, supply chain, customer service, and after-sales
Preferred competencies and qualifications
- Bachelor's degree or higher in finance, accounting, taxation, or related fields
- Familiarity with accounting standards, tax laws, and basic financial principles
- Proficient in Excel and financial software with strong data analysis skills
- Demonstrated ability to learn quickly, work collaboratively, and execute tasks with clear logical thinking and effective communication under pressure
